About Aladdin Ayesh
Aladdin Ayesh is a scholar working on Artificial Intelligence, Computer Networks and Communications, Information Systems, Computer Vision and Pattern Recognition and Experimental and Cognitive Psychology, having authored 108 papers that have together received 1.3k indexed citations. Recurring topics across this work include Emotion and Mood Recognition (18 papers), Natural Language Processing Techniques (10 papers), EEG and Brain-Computer Interfaces (7 papers), Data Mining Algorithms and Applications (7 papers), Mobile Agent-Based Network Management (7 papers), Text and Document Classification Technologies (7 papers), Topic Modeling (6 papers) and Gaze Tracking and Assistive Technology (6 papers). The work is most often cited by research in Signal Processing (227 citations), Information Systems (429 citations), Computer Networks and Communications (430 citations), Artificial Intelligence (548 citations) and Software (50 citations). Aladdin Ayesh has collaborated with scholars based in United Kingdom, Jordan and Spain. Frequent co-authors include Neda Abdelhamid, Fadi Thabtah, Alaa Sheta, Alex Shenfield, Malik Braik, David C. Rine, Martin Stacey, Wael Hadi, Meshrif Alruily and Hussein Zedan. Their work appears in journals such as Cognitive Computation, International Journal of Bio-Inspired Computation, IEEE Technology and Society Magazine, Expert Systems with Applications and Robotica.
